如何在app即时通讯系统中实现个性化消息提示功能?
随着移动互联网的快速发展,即时通讯(IM)应用已经成为人们日常沟通的重要工具。在众多即时通讯应用中,个性化消息提示功能是提升用户体验的关键因素之一。本文将探讨如何在app即时通讯系统中实现个性化消息提示功能。
一、个性化消息提示的重要性
提高用户粘性:个性化消息提示能够根据用户的需求和喜好,提供更加贴心的服务,从而提高用户对应用的粘性。
优化用户体验:通过个性化消息提示,用户可以快速了解重要信息,提高沟通效率,提升用户体验。
增强应用竞争力:在众多即时通讯应用中,具有个性化消息提示功能的应用更能吸引和留住用户,从而增强应用竞争力。
二、实现个性化消息提示的步骤
- 用户画像分析
(1)收集用户数据:通过用户注册、登录、使用应用等行为,收集用户的基本信息、兴趣爱好、社交关系等数据。
(2)数据分析:对收集到的用户数据进行统计分析,挖掘用户特征和需求。
(3)建立用户画像:根据数据分析结果,为每个用户创建一个包含兴趣爱好、社交关系、行为习惯等信息的用户画像。
- 消息内容定制
(1)消息分类:根据用户画像,将消息分为不同类别,如好友动态、活动通知、系统公告等。
(2)消息权重设置:根据用户画像和消息类型,为每条消息设置权重,优先推送重要消息。
(3)消息内容优化:针对不同用户画像,优化消息内容,使其更具吸引力。
- 消息推送策略
(1)推送时机:根据用户活跃时间段、兴趣爱好等,选择合适的推送时机。
(2)推送频率:根据用户画像和消息权重,合理设置推送频率,避免过度打扰用户。
(3)推送渠道:结合用户偏好,选择合适的推送渠道,如短信、邮件、应用内推送等。
- 消息反馈与优化
(1)用户反馈:收集用户对个性化消息提示的反馈,了解用户需求和满意度。
(2)数据分析:对用户反馈进行数据分析,找出问题所在。
(3)优化调整:根据用户反馈和数据分析结果,对个性化消息提示功能进行优化调整。
三、实现个性化消息提示的技术手段
数据挖掘与机器学习:通过数据挖掘和机器学习技术,分析用户行为,为用户提供个性化推荐。
人工智能:利用人工智能技术,实现智能对话、智能回复等功能,提高消息推送的准确性。
云计算:利用云计算技术,实现消息推送的快速、稳定和高效。
网络优化:通过优化网络传输,提高消息推送速度,降低延迟。
四、总结
个性化消息提示功能是提升即时通讯应用用户体验的关键因素。通过用户画像分析、消息内容定制、消息推送策略等技术手段,可以实现个性化消息提示功能。在实际应用中,还需不断优化和调整,以满足用户需求,提升应用竞争力。
猜你喜欢:IM服务